Yama. Yama is the Hindu god of death in the Vedic pantheon. He is the son of the sun god, Surya, and the twin brother of Yami. As the god of death, Yama is responsible for judging the souls of the deceased and determining their fate. He is often depicted as an old man with a long white beard and four arms.

Kuraokami (闇龗) is a legendary Japanese dragon and Shinto deity of rain and snow.
